Bonjour, je cherche à créer des tables sous mysql à partir de fichiers .csv et les champs correspondraient à la première ligne lue dans le fichier csv, est ce que quelqu'un aurait une idée de comment faire?

Par exemple, j'ai un fichier personne.csv, avec pour première ligne de ce fichier, "nom", "prénom", "adresse", "cp", "ville","telephone" et bien entendu dans le fichier csv les autres lignes correspondent aux données. Je voudrais donc crée une table avec comme nom "personne" et les champs de la première ligne du fichier.
Ensuite j'insère les données avec la méthode "LOAD DATA LOCAL INFILE" mais je souhaitait automatiser ce principe.. voilà j'espère que mon explication est compréhensible, si quelqu'un voit comment faire ? Je vous remercie d'avance,

bonne journée